Horizon Utilities to Increase Grid Reliability, Tighten Supply Chain With IFS Applications
IFS announced that Horizon Utilities, the third largest municipally-owned electricity distribution company in Ontario, has selected IFS Applications to help it manage its facilities in Hamilton, St. Catharines, and Stoney Creek, Ontario.
Horizon Utilities will implement IFS Applications to streamline infrastructure improvement and maintenance activities, and to tighten its supply chain for raw materials and parts. The utility will also implement IFS Applications for finance and human resources management.
"Ensuring the reliability of our physical assets is our top priority," Horizon Utilities Senior Vice President and Chief Financial Officer John Basilio said. "Moving from our various existing computer systems to a unified enterprise application will allow us to manage our maintenance crews and capital projects more effectively - and that increases grid reliability and allows us to better serve our business and residential customers."
IFS is a leading application vendor to the energy and utilities industry, and has more than 130 customers involved in power generation, transmission & distribution and water & sewage. Customers include the world's largest hydropower plant, Three Gorges (P. R. China), nuclear power plants OKG (Sweden), PBMR (South Africa) and Qinshan (P. R. China), grid operators such as Svenska Kraftnät (Sweden), Statnett (Norway) and TenneT (The Netherlands) as well as distributors such as Vattenfall (Sweden), Fortum (Sweden), and Hafslund Energi (Norway). Reliable and safe asset management and workforce management are critical processes in the energy and utility industry, to which IFS has provided solutions for more than 20 years.

About Horizon Utilities
Horizon Utilities Corporation is the third largest municipally owned electricity distribution company in Ontario and provides electricity and related utility services to over 231,000 residential and commercial customers in Hamilton and St. Catharines. The company is owned by Hamilton Utilities Corporation and St. Catharines Hydro Inc. and operates out of facilities in Hamilton, St. Catharines, and Stoney Creek. Horizon Utilities is regulated by the Ontario Energy Board. Horizon's 360 employees are committed to delivering a safe and reliable supply of electricity, providing unparalleled customer value and helping to create a culture of energy conservation in Ontario.
